Transaction ff5a96f08822149bcc65a2ccfc21a837bf792720b37c168b2dba540ad8812068

1 Input
2 Outputs
  • ff5a96f08822149bcc65a2ccfc21a837bf792720b37c168b2dba540ad8812068:0
  • value  599000
    address  18YfakCR2MadTTaFCxTLuAeNhLEyvEYmiB
  • ff5a96f08822149bcc65a2ccfc21a837bf792720b37c168b2dba540ad8812068:1
  • value  155810140
    address  1JyWdyzJxUNDFmmRHPcQXk3C5X7BbSQekg